An associate video editor is responsible for assisting in the post-production process of creating videos. They work closely with the video editing team to assemble raw footage, trim and rearrange scenes, and ensure the final output meets the desired vision. They may also be involved in color correction, audio editing, and adding special effects or graphics. Additionally, associate video editors may collaborate with other departments such as video producers, scriptwriters, and directors to understand the project requirements and deliver high-quality videos within the given timeframe. This role requires proficiency in video editing software such as Adobe Premiere Pro or Final Cut Pro, as well as a keen eye for detail, creativity, and the ability to work under tight deadlines.

Associate Video Editor salary in Norway
Average Yearly Salary of Associate Video Editor in Norway is approximately 920,993 NOK (83,741 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
